11 namespace mojo { | |
12 | |
13 // InterfaceImpl<..> is designed to be the base class of an interface | |
14 // implementation. It may be bound to a pipe or a proxy, see BindToPipe and | |
15 // BindToProxy. | |
16 // | |
17 // NOTE: A base class of WithErrorHandler<Interface> is used to avoid multiple | |
18 // inheritance. This base class inserts the signature of ErrorHandler into the | |
19 // inheritance chain. | |
20 template <typename Interface> | |
21 class InterfaceImpl : public WithErrorHandler<Interface> { | |
22 public: | |
23 InterfaceImpl() : internal_state_(this) {} | |
24 virtual ~InterfaceImpl() {} | |
25 | |
26 // Subclasses must handle connection errors. | |
27 virtual void OnConnectionError() = 0; | |
28 | |
29 // DO NOT USE. Exposed only for internal use and for testing. | |

39 // Takes an instance of an InterfaceImpl<..> subclass and binds it to the given | |
40 // MessagePipe. The instance is returned for convenience in member initializer | |
41 // lists, etc. If the pipe is closed, the instance's OnConnectionError method | |
42 // will be called. | |
43 // | |
44 // The instance is also bound to the current thread. Its methods will only be | |
45 // called on the current thread, and if the current thread exits, then it will | |
46 // also be deleted, and along with it, its end point of the pipe will be closed. | |
47 // | |
48 // Before returning, the instance will receive a SetClient call, providing it | |
49 // with a proxy to the client on the other end of the pipe. | |
50 template <typename Impl> | |
51 Impl* BindToPipe(Impl* instance, | |
52 ScopedMessagePipeHandle handle, | |
53 MojoAsyncWaiter* waiter = GetDefaultAsyncWaiter()) { | |
54 instance->internal_state()->Bind(handle.Pass(), waiter); | |
55 return instance; | |
56 } | |
